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Acton Bridge (Cheshire) to Larkhall start from £100.00 one way, or £142.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ities

While Acton Bridge (Cheshire) Station might have a no-frills appearance, it accommodates the fundamental needs of its passengers. Though there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for your convenience, including accessible options. Unfortunately, you cannot collect tickets bought online at this station. Smartcards are neither issued nor validated here, and you’ll find no waiting rooms or shops for refreshments. However, on the plus side, the station has a small parking area available to travelers, which is open 24 hours a day, and best of all, parking here is free!

The station doesn’t possess step-free access, making mobility a challenge for some passengers. However, an assistance meeting point is available on the platform for those needing help boarding the train. Bear in mind, there’s no staff on hand for assistance at any time, so pre-arrangement through passenger assist services is advised for those needing help with access.

Station Amenities & Facilities

Larkhall train station offers a variety of amenities for travelers. While there is no ticket office, you can easily collect pre-purchased tickets from the available ticket machines. It’s easily accessible with step-free pathways throughout, making it a Category A station, and complete with services such as CCTV and help points to ensure safety and assistance if needed. Despite the absence of refreshment facilities, public Wi-Fi, or even an ATM, the station makes up for it with its functional simplicity and ease of navigation, especially for those with accessibility needs. Blue Badge parking is available, with 13 designated spaces to cater to users requiring easy access.

Onward Transport Options

Larkhall station is integrally linked with various modes of transport. For those moments when the trains are interrupted, a rail replacement bus service can be boarded on Caledonian Road, right across from the Police Station. The station also features easy access to taxis, with details available via TrainTaxi services. For bus enthusiasts, there’s comprehensive information on routes and services available on Traveline Scotland, ensuring your journey is smooth from start to finish.
